Early Foundations: From Quality Analyst to Compliance Strategist
My professional evolution began with foundational roles in operations and quality assurance at firms like NorthgateArinso, Credit Suisse, and Lehman Brothers. These formative years shaped my understanding of systems thinking, operational controls, and business continuity — critical aspects for anyone entering the world of information security.
At Euronet Worldwide, I stepped into audit and compliance leadership, managing regulatory alignment and security certifications for complex financial systems — including PCI DSS and ISO standards. It was here I began embedding frameworks like ISO 9001 and ISO 27001 into daily operations, ensuring security wasn’t a checkbox — it was a culture.
Leadership in Financial Services: Redefining Cyber Risk at Scale
My time with YES BANK and AGS Transact Technologies marked a defining phase in my leadership journey. As AVP and Manager of IT Security, I built and led teams responsible for enterprise security posture, vendor risk assessments, internal audit programs, and compliance management across banking channels and ATM ecosystems.
Risk management in banking is not only about regulatory compliance — it’s about protecting trust. By integrating security governance, policy frameworks, and continuous control monitoring, we ensured resilience at every level — from customer-facing interfaces to backend infrastructure.
